
.about .content{height:260px;}
.about .content p{line-height:26px;color:#656565;font-size:14px;}

.video{position:relative;padding-top:130px;height:263px;background:url(../images/about/videoBg.jpg) no-repeat center;}
.videoContent .title{cursor:pointer;margin:0 auto;width:242px;height:50px;line-height:50px;border:3px solid #fff;text-align:center;color:#fff;font-family:Century Gothic;font-size:26px;}
.videoContent .title img{ vertical-align:middle;margin:0 6px;}
.videoContent .title span{ vertical-align:middle;}
.videoContent .info{font-size:26px;color:#fff;text-align:center;line-height:32px;padding:10px 0;}

.culture .cultureNav{padding:30px 0;text-align:center;height:174px;background:url(../images/about/cultureNavBg.jpg) repeat-x;background-position:center;}
.culture .cultureNav .child{cursor:pointer;position:relative;width:174px;height:174px;margin:0 14px;display:inline-block;*display:inline;*zoom:1;}
.culture .cultureNav .child .childImg{position:absolute;top:0px;bottom:0px;left:0px;right:0px;margin:auto;width:127px;height:127px;border:1px solid #dbdbdb;background-color:#fff;background-repeat:no-repeat;background-position:center;border-radius:127px;-moz-border-radius:127px;-ms-border-radius:127px;-o-border-radius:127px;-webkit-border-radius:127px;}
.culture .cultureNav .child .childQuan1{display:none;position:absolute;top:0px;left:0px;width:174px;}
.culture .cultureNav .child .childQuan2{display:none;position:absolute;top:0px;bottom:0px;left:0px;right:0px;margin:auto;}
.culture .cultureNav .child.child1 .childImg{background-image:url(../images/about/icon1.png);}
.culture .cultureNav .child.child2 .childImg{background-image:url(../images/about/icon2.png);}
.culture .cultureNav .child.child3 .childImg{background-image:url(../images/about/icon3.png);}
.culture .cultureNav .child.child4 .childImg{background-image:url(../images/about/icon4.png);}
.culture .cultureNav .child.child5 .childImg{background-image:url(../images/about/icon5.png);}
.culture .cultureNav .child.on .childImg{background-color:#d6281a;border:1px solid #d6281a;}
.culture .cultureNav .child.on .childQuan1{display:block;
animation:cultureNavQuan1 1s  ease-in-out 0s infinite;
-moz-animation:cultureNavQuan1 1s  ease-in-out 0s  infinite;
-webkit-animation:cultureNavQuan1 1s  ease-in-out 0s  infinite;
-o-animation:cultureNavQuan1 1s  ease-in-out 0s  infinite;}
.culture .cultureNav .child.on .childQuan2{display:block;}
.culture .cultureNav .child.child1.on .childImg{background-image:url(../images/about/icon1On.png);}
.culture .cultureNav .child.child2.on .childImg{background-image:url(../images/about/icon2On.png);}
.culture .cultureNav .child.child3.on .childImg{background-image:url(../images/about/icon3On.png);}
.culture .cultureNav .child.child4.on .childImg{background-image:url(../images/about/icon4On.png);}
.culture .cultureNav .child.child5.on .childImg{background-image:url(../images/about/icon5On.png);}
.culture .cultureNav .child:hover .childImg{background-color:#d6281a;border:1px solid #d6281a;}
.culture .cultureNav .child:hover .childImg{
animation:cultureNavImg .5s  ease-in-out 0s  both;
-moz-animation:cultureNavImg .5s  ease-in-out 0s  both;
-webkit-animation:cultureNavImg .5s  ease-in-out 0s  both;
-o-animation:cultureNavImg .5s  ease-in-out 0s  both;}
.culture .cultureNav .child:hover .childQuan1{display:block;
animation:cultureNavQuan1 .5s  ease-in-out 0s infinite;
-moz-animation:cultureNavQuan1 .5s  ease-in-out 0s  infinite;
-webkit-animation:cultureNavQuan1 .5s  ease-in-out 0s  infinite;
-o-animation:cultureNavQuan1 .5s  ease-in-out 0s  infinite;}
.culture .cultureNav .child:hover .childQuan2{display:block;
animation:cultureNavQuan2 .5s  ease-in-out 0s  both;
-moz-animation:cultureNavQuan2 .5s  ease-in-out 0s  both;
-webkit-animation:cultureNavQuan2 .5s  ease-in-out 0s  both;
-o-animation:cultureNavQuan2 .5s  ease-in-out 0s  both;}
.culture .cultureNav .child.child1:hover .childImg{background-image:url(../images/about/icon1On.png);}
.culture .cultureNav .child.child2:hover .childImg{background-image:url(../images/about/icon2On.png);}
.culture .cultureNav .child.child3:hover .childImg{background-image:url(../images/about/icon3On.png);}
.culture .cultureNav .child.child4:hover .childImg{background-image:url(../images/about/icon4On.png);}
.culture .cultureNav .child.child5:hover .childImg{background-image:url(../images/about/icon5On.png);}
.culture .content{padding:10px 0;text-align:center;}
.culture .content .child{display:none;}
.culture .content .child.on{display:block;}
.culture .content p{color:#656565;font-size:14px;line-height:26px;}
.culture .content .title{color:#656565;font-size:30px;line-height:42px;padding-bottom:26px;}

.history{background:#f5f5f5;}
.historyNav{position:relative;height:100px;}
.historyNav .historyBtn{position:absolute;top:0px;cursor:pointer;}
.historyNav .historyBtn.leftBtn{left:0px;}
.historyNav .historyBtn.rightBtn{right:0px;}
.historyNav .content{overflow:hidden;position:relative;margin:0 auto;width:900px;height:100px;background:url(../images/about/cultureNavBg.jpg) repeat-x;background-position:center 30px;}
.historyNav .content .moveContent{position:absolute;top:0px;left:0px;}
.historyNav .content .child{cursor:pointer;position:absolute;top:19px;width:90px;}
.historyNav .content .child .childImg{position:absolute;top:0px;left:0px;right:0px;margin:0 auto;width:20px;height:20px;border:1px solid #d6d6d6;background:#fff;border-radius:20px;-moz-border-radius:20px;-ms-border-radius:20px;-o-border-radius:20px;-webkit-border-radius:20px;}
.historyNav .content .child .childImg .childImgPointer{display:none;position:absolute;top:0px;bottom:0px;left:0px;right:0px;margin:auto;background:#d6281a;width:12px;height:12px;border-radius:12px;-moz-border-radius:12px;-ms-border-radius:12px;-o-border-radius:12px;-webkit-border-radius:12px;}
.historyNav .content .child .childTitle{text-align:center;font-family:Century Gothic,Arial, Helvetica, sans-serif;position:absolute;top:36px;left:0px;width:90%;line-height:33px;color:#656565;font-size:16px;}
.historyNav .content .child .childTitle .pointer{display:none;position:absolute;left:0px;right:0px;top:-8px;height:8px;margin:0 auto;}
.historyNav .content .child.on .childImg .childImgPointer{display:block;}
.historyNav .content .child.on .childTitle{color:#D52719;font-size:24px;border:1px solid #d6281a;border-radius:5px;-moz-border-radius:5px;-ms-border-radius:5px;-o-border-radius:5px;-webkit-border-radius:5px;}
.historyNav .content .child.on .childTitle .pointer{display:block;}

.historyContent{padding-top:60px;}
.historyContent .child{display:none;}
.historyContent .child.on{display:block;}
.historyContent .child:after{content: "020"; display: block; height: 0; clear: both;visibility:hidden;}
.historyContent .child .childImg{width:423px;float:left;text-align:center;}
.historyContent .child .childInfo{float:left;width:495px;margin-left:75px;height:280px;}
.historyContent .child .childInfo p{line-height:28px;color:#656565;font-size:14px;}

.videoShow .content{position:relative;height:271px;width:100%;margin-top:50px;}
.videoShow .content .videoShowBtn{position:absolute;top:0px;bottom:0px;margin:auto 0;cursor:pointer;z-index:1;}
.videoShow .content .videoShowBtn.leftBtn{left:-100px;}
.videoShow .content .videoShowBtn.rightBtn{right:-100px;}
.videoShow .content .contents{position:relative;height:271px;width:100%;overflow:hidden;}
.videoShow .content .moveContent{position:absolute;top:0px;left:0px;}
.videoShow .content .moveContent .child{position:absolute;top:0px;width:369px;height:271px;margin-right:28px;cursor:pointer;}
.videoShow .content .moveContent .child .childImg{width:100%;height:100%;overflow:hidden;}
.videoShow .content .moveContent .child .childImg img{width:100%;height:100%;}
.videoShow .content .moveContent .child .childImg img{transition-duration: .3s;-ms-transition-duration: .3s;-moz-transition-duration: .3s; -webkit-transition-duration:.3s; }
.videoShow .content .moveContent .child:hover .childImg img{transform:scale(1.1);-webkit-transform:scale(1.1);-moz-transform:scale(1.1);-ms-transform:scale(1.1);-o-transform:scale(1.1);}

.videoShow .content .moveContent .child .childIcon{position:absolute;top:0px;bottom:0px;left:0px;right:0px;margin:auto;}

.honer .content{margin-top:0px;}
.honer .content .child{position:relative;overflow:hidden;}
.honer .content .child .loading{position:absolute;top:0px;bottom:0px;left:0px;right:0px;margin:auto;display:none;}
.honer .content .child:after{content: "020"; display: block; height: 0; clear: both;visibility:hidden;}
.honer .content .child .childChild{width:20%;height:auto;float:left;text-align:center;padding:4px 0;}
.honer .content .child .childChild img{width:98%;vertical-align:middle;}
.honer .honerBtn{width:200px;height:40px;line-height:40px;text-align:center;border:2px solid #df0024;color:#df0024;font-size:20px;margin:10px auto;cursor:pointer;}
.honer .honerBtn.hidebtn{display:none;}

.superiority{border-bottom:1px solid #cacaca;}
.superiority .mainNav .child{width:auto;padding:0 12px;}
.superiority .content .child{position:relative;text-align:center;width:100%;}
.superiority .content .child .loading{position:absolute;top:0px;bottom:0px;left:0px;right:0px;margin:auto;display:none;}
.superiority .content .child:after{content: "020"; display: block; height: 0; clear: both;visibility:hidden;}
.superiority .content .child .childChild{ vertical-align:top;text-align:left;position:relative;width:376px;margin:4px 4px;display:inline-block;*display:inline;*zoom:1;}
.superiority .content .child .childChild .childImg{width:100%;height:auto;}
.superiority .content .child .childChild .childImg img{width:100%;}
.superiority .content .child .childChild .childTitle{padding:38px 0 26px 0;line-height:28px;color:#656565;font-size:20px;}
.superiority .content .child .childChild .childInfo p{color:#777777;font-size:14px;line-height:24px;}

.recruit{border-bottom:1px solid #cacaca;}
.recruit .mainInfo{width:770px;margin:0 auto;font-size:14px;color:#777777;line-height:24px;}
.recruit .content .contentImg{padding:16px 0 50px 0;text-align:center;}
.recruit .content .childsTitle{width:769px;margin:0 auto;}
.recruit .content .childsTitle:after{content: "020"; display: block; height: 0; clear: both;visibility:hidden;}
.recruit .content .childsTitle .child{width:223px;float:left;margin-right:50px;cursor:pointer;}
.recruit .content .childsTitle .child.no{margin-right:0;}
.recruit .content .childsTitle .child .childTitle{height:48px;line-height:48px;}
.recruit .content .childsTitle .child .childTitle .ch{color:#434343;font-size:18px;margin-right:4px;}
.recruit .content .childsTitle .child .childTitle .en{color:#999999;font-size:12px;font-family:Arial, Helvetica, sans-serif;}
.recruit .content .childsTitle .child .childSub{height:5px;background:#cccccc;}
.recruit .content .childsTitle .child.on .childTitle .ch{color:#D52719;}
.recruit .content .childsTitle .child.on .childSub{background:#D52719;}
.recruit .content .childsTitle .child:hover .childTitle .ch{color:#D52719;}
.recruit .content .childsTitle .child:hover .childSub{background:#D52719;}
.recruit .content .childsContent{padding-top:30px;width:769px;margin:0 auto;}
.recruit .content .childsContent .child{display:none;}
.recruit .content .childsContent .child.on{display:block;}
.recruit .content .childsContent .child p{line-height:24px;color:#656565;font-size:14px;}
.recruit .content .childsContent .child p span{color:#999;margin-right:6px;}
@media (max-width: 639px) {

.about .content{height:160px;}
.about .content p{line-height:20px;font-size:12px;}

.video{padding-top:50px;height:150px;background-size:auto 200px;}
.videoContent .title{width:180px;height:40px;line-height:40px;border:2px solid #fff;font-size:20px;}
.videoContent .title img{width:12px;margin:0 6px;}
.videoContent .info{font-size:20px;line-height:28px;padding:2px 0;}

.culture{display:none;}
.culture .cultureNav{padding:10px 0;height:auto;background:none;}
.culture .cultureNav .child{width:87px;height:87px;margin:0 6px;}
.culture .cultureNav .child .childImg{width:63px;height:63px;background-size:36px auto;border-radius:63px;-moz-border-radius:63px;-ms-border-radius:63px;-o-border-radius:63px;-webkit-border-radius:63px;}
.culture .cultureNav .child .childQuan1{width:87px;}
.culture .cultureNav .child .childQuan2{width:72px;}
.culture .content{padding:6px 0;}
.culture .content p{font-size:12px;line-height:20px;}
.culture .content .title{font-size:20px;line-height:26px;padding-bottom:10px;}

.historyNav{height:80px;}
.historyNav .historyBtn{width:36px;top:12px;}
.historyNav .content{width:225px;height:80px;background-position:center 30px;}
.historyNav .content .child{top:19px;width:45px;}
.historyNav .content .child .childImg{width:20px;height:20px;border-radius:20px;-moz-border-radius:20px;-ms-border-radius:20px;-o-border-radius:20px;-webkit-border-radius:20px;}
.historyNav .content .child .childImg .childImgPointer{width:12px;height:12px;border-radius:12px;-moz-border-radius:12px;-ms-border-radius:12px;-o-border-radius:12px;-webkit-border-radius:12px;}
.historyNav .content .child .childTitle{top:36px;line-height:20px;font-size:12px;}
.historyNav .content .child .childTitle .pointer{top:-4px;height:4px;}
.historyNav .content .child.on .childTitle{font-size:16px;}

.historyContent{padding-top:20px;}

.historyContent .child .childImg{width:100%;float:none;padding:0 0 20px 0;}
.historyContent .child .childImg img{max-width:100%;}
.historyContent .child .childInfo{float:none;width:100%;margin-left:0px;height:280px;}
.historyContent .child .childInfo p{line-height:20px;font-size:12px;}

.videoShow .content{height:220px;width:300px;margin:20px auto 0 auto;}
.videoShow .content .videoShowBtn.leftBtn{left:0px;}
.videoShow .content .videoShowBtn.rightBtn{right:0px;}
.videoShow .content .contents{height:220px;width:300px;margin:0 auto;}
.videoShow .content .moveContent .child{width:300px;height:220px;margin-right:14px;}


.honer .content{margin-top:0px;}
.honer .content .child .childChild{width:50%;padding:2px 0;}

.superiority .mainNav .child{padding:0 12px;}
.superiority .content .child .childChild{width:100%;margin:4px 0;}

.superiority .content .child .childChild .childTitle{padding:10px 0;line-height:20px;font-size:14px;}
.superiority .content .child .childChild .childInfo p{font-size:12px;line-height:20px;}

.recruit .mainInfo{width:100%;font-size:12px;line-height:20px;}
.recruit .content .contentImg{padding:10px 0;}
.recruit .content .contentImg img{max-width:100%;}
.recruit .content .childsTitle{width:100%;}
.recruit .content .childsTitle .child{width:30%;margin-right:5%;}
.recruit .content .childsTitle .child .childTitle{height:30px;line-height:30px;text-align:center;}
.recruit .content .childsTitle .child .childTitle .ch{font-size:14px;margin-right:0px;}
.recruit .content .childsTitle .child .childTitle .en{display:none;}
.recruit .content .childsTitle .child .childSub{height:3px;}
.recruit .content .childsContent{padding-top:10px;width:100%;}
.recruit .content .childsContent .child p{line-height:20px;font-size:12px;}
}
@media (min-width: 640px) and (max-width:1023px ) {

.culture .cultureNav{padding:20px 0;height:auto;background:none;}
.culture .cultureNav .child{width:174px;height:174px;margin:0 14px;}
.culture .cultureNav .child .childImg{width:127px;height:127px;border-radius:127px;-moz-border-radius:127px;-ms-border-radius:127px;-o-border-radius:127px;-webkit-border-radius:127px;}
.culture .cultureNav .child .childQuan1{width:174px;}
.culture .cultureNav .child .childQuan2{width:140px;}
.culture .content{padding:10px 0;}
.culture .content p{font-size:14px;line-height:26px;}
.culture .content .title{font-size:30px;line-height:42px;padding-bottom:26px;}

.historyNav{height:100px;}
.historyNav .content{width:450px;height:100px;background-position:center 30px;}
.historyNav .content .child{top:19px;width:90px;}
.historyNav .content .child .childImg{width:20px;height:20px;border-radius:20px;-moz-border-radius:20px;-ms-border-radius:20px;-o-border-radius:20px;-webkit-border-radius:20px;}
.historyNav .content .child .childImg .childImgPointer{width:12px;height:12px;border-radius:12px;-moz-border-radius:12px;-ms-border-radius:12px;-o-border-radius:12px;-webkit-border-radius:12px;}
.historyNav .content .child .childTitle{top:36px;line-height:33px;font-size:16px;}
.historyNav .content .child .childTitle .pointer{top:-8px;height:8px;}
.historyNav .content .child.on .childTitle{font-size:24px;}

.historyContent{padding-top:60px;}

.historyContent .child .childImg{width:100%;float:none;padding:0 0 20px 0;}
.historyContent .child .childInfo{float:none;width:100%;margin-left:0px;height:280px;}
.historyContent .child .childInfo p{line-height:28px;color:#656565;font-size:14px;}

.videoShow .content{height:271px;width:369px;margin:50px auto 0 auto;}
.videoShow .content .videoShowBtn.leftBtn{left:-100px;}
.videoShow .content .videoShowBtn.rightBtn{right:-100px;}
.videoShow .content .contents{height:271px;width:369px;}
.videoShow .content .moveContent .child{width:369px;height:271px;margin-right:28px;}


.honer .content{margin-top:50px;}
.honer .content .child .childChild{width:50%;padding:4px 0;}

.superiority .mainNav .child{padding:0 12px;}
.superiority .content .child .childChild{width:376px;margin:4px 4px;}
.superiority .content .child .childChild .childTitle{padding:16px 0;line-height:28px;font-size:20px;}
.superiority .content .child .childChild .childInfo p{font-size:14px;line-height:24px;}

.recruit .mainInfo{width:100%;font-size:14px;line-height:24px;}
.recruit .content .contentImg{padding:16px 0 20px 0;}
.recruit .content .contentImg img{max-width:100%;}
.recruit .content .childsTitle{width:100%;}
.recruit .content .childsTitle .child{width:30%;margin-right:5%;}
.recruit .content .childsTitle .child .childTitle{height:48px;line-height:48px;text-align:center;}
.recruit .content .childsTitle .child .childTitle .ch{font-size:18px;margin-right:4px;}
.recruit .content .childsTitle .child .childTitle .en{display:none;}
.recruit .content .childsTitle .child .childSub{height:5px;}
.recruit .content .childsContent{padding-top:30px;width:100%;}
.recruit .content .childsContent .child p{line-height:24px;font-size:14px;}

}
@media (min-width: 1024px) and (max-width:1199px ) {


}
@media (min-width: 1200px) and (max-width:1439px ) {


}
@media (min-width: 1440px) and (max-width:1920px ) {



}